Description Michal Jaegermann 2005-03-14 05:17:42 UTC
Description of problem:

$ rpm -qi dhclient
....
Summary     : Development headers and libraries for interfacing to the
DHCP server
....

Looks like a "copy-and-waste".

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
dhclient-3.0.1-40_FC3
dhclient-3.0.2-3 in the current rawhide.

Comment 1 Jason Vas Dias 2005-03-14 19:46:04 UTC
Yep, it looks like dhclient's "Summary:" line was copied straight from 
dhcp-devel - it looks like it has been this way since Aug 16, 2002,
when the dhclient- subpackage first appeared in dhcp-3.0pl1-6 .
Well spotted ! This will be remedied in the next version.

Comment 2 Jason Vas Dias 2005-07-14 22:00:26 UTC
Now fixed with dhcp-3.0.1-44_FC3
